George Malik, who writes and compiles the MLIVE Snapshots blog posted his Red Wings preview over at Kukla’s Korner.

He provides a very comprehensive post on the expectations many in the media had for Detroit prior to last season and the makeup of this year’s team. I think he has an interesting take on the decision to put Kris Draper on Val Filppula’s wing.

I really like the concept of making Draper a winger for Filppula, because Fil still has a tendency to out-skate his wingers, and, sometimes, even himself, so Draper finally gives Fil someone who can keep up and provide a high-speed outlet. The entire line is extremely responsible defensively, they have a speedy transition game that the top two lines can’t keep up with…Cleary is what makes this line work, however, because he provides that net-front presence and sneaky snap shot that accentuates Filppula and Draper’s solid all-round game with some blue-collar offensive jam.

Bruce MacLeod from the Macomb Daily did a sort of live blog of last night’s exhibition game against the New York Rangers. He didn’t do the live blog from his excellent Red Wings Corner blog though - he did it in the Gameday Thread over at Red Wings Central. It’s definitely worth a read.

The good news is Igor Grigorenko is starting to show some signs of catching up to the NHL game. He took Dan Cleary’s spot on the third line and played well. When the Wings built up a large lead he was also put on the ice with Datsyuk.
